7.   Consent Agenda:
The Consent Agenda includes routine items that may be acted upon with a single vote. Any council member may remove items from the Consent Agenda for separate discussion and consideration.
 
a.   Consider approving the minutes of the April 19, 2022 Special Called City Council Meeting and April 26, 2022 Regular City Council Meeting. Click to View
 
b.   Receive Quarterly Investment Report for the quarter ending March 31, 2022. Click to View
 
c.   Consider  approving Resolution No. R22-650 which supports the submission of an application for a Selective Traffic Enforcement Program (STEP) Grant from the Texas Department of Transportation (TxDOT) for reimbursement of Law Enforcement. Click to View
 
d.   Consider approving Resolution No. R22-652 which designates the second Saturday in May 2022 as World Migratory Bird Day in Cedar Hill. Click to View
